Review of The Diving Bell and the Butterfly (2007) by Burstnbloom- Timothy Brock — 14 Jul 2009
Found the movie a little disappointing after having read the book. Where the book focussed entirely on his thoughts and perceptions during his struggle to live in that immobile state, the movie shifted it to an external view - where you get to see his family and the impact his life, both before and after the stroke, had on them.
That somehow made his life, thoughts and motivations a little less admirable for me!
